Transaction 686cb3ad9e641f2999c67f39ebca26d7687d9e65a268833590c2fe8bbc68a02e
1 Input
1 Output
-
686cb3ad9e641f2999c67f39ebca26d7687d9e65a268833590c2fe8bbc68a02e:0
- value
- 14869608
- script pubkey
- OP_0 OP_PUSHBYTES_20 80630beca4ff76b2080c5e63e47053f30da671a8
- address
- bc1qsp3shm9ylamtyzqvte37guzn7vx6vudgl0k2ja